| Thomas Gillian Boggs Home Edgemont Ave, Liberty SC 1955 CLICK FOR LARGER VIEW |
Originally it was a 5 room log house and added to significantly over the years ~ even adding two stories!
The original log home was built from timber that was on the property and hewn on spot. When the home was taken down in 1955, most of the house was "re-used" elsewhere in Liberty, resold, and parts donated to the family.
Pieces were used to make various wood items that are inside many Liberty churches today.
Thomas Gillian Boggs is credited as one of the founding leaders of Presbyterianism in Liberty.
